Irena Madjar is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Irena Madjar has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 230 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in General Health Professions, 5 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 3 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ine. Recurrent topics in Irena Madjar's work include Pain Management and Opioid Use (3 papers), Education Systems and Policy (3 papers) and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(3 papers). Irena Madjar is often cited by papers focused on Pain Management and Opioid Use (3 papers), Education Systems and Policy (3 papers) and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(3 papers). Irena Madjar collaborates with scholars based in Australia, New Zealand and Israel. Irena Madjar's co-authors include Yun‐Hee Jeon, Isabel Higgins, James W. Denham, Aaron Wilson, Stuart McNaughton, Samuel Ariad, Prem Rashid, Dor J, Elizabeth McKinley and Gilad Ben‐Baruch and has published in prestigious journals such as Qualitative Health Research, Journal of Nursing Management and Nursing Inquiry.
